MoWest Military and Veteran Services At Missouri Western State University Military & Veteran Services, we proudly serve those who have served.

We support active-duty members, veterans, reservists, and military families with education benefits, career guidance, and transition resources.

Mark Your Calendars | September 8–11, 2026

Twenty-five years ago, our nation changed forever.

This September, the MoWest Center for Service is honored to partner with MoWest Military and Veteran Services, local first responders, and community partners to commemorate the 25th Anniversary of 9/11 with a week of remembrance, service, and gratitude.

Together, we will honor the nearly 3,000 lives lost on September 11, 2001, remember the incredible courage of the firefighters, law enforcement officers, EMS personnel, military members, and everyday heroes who answered the call, and recognize the thousands of first responders who spent months at Ground Zero helping with rescue, recovery, and cleanup efforts.

Throughout the week, we invite Griffons and members of the community to join us as we remember, reflect, and serve. Every event is free and open to the public, because if there's one thing we learned from this tragic day, we are better together!

As we approach this significant milestone, may we never forget the strength, sacrifice, and unity that emerged from one of our nation's darkest days.

Save the date. Invite your family and friends.
Join us as we remember the past, honor our heroes, and recognize those who continue to step in to action in the face of danger.
